Compare all specifications:
2005 Ferrari 575M Maranello | 2004 Honda Mobilio | |
Make | Ferrari | Honda |
Model | 575M Maranello | Mobilio |
Year Released | 2005 | 2004 |
Engine Position | Front | Front |
Engine Size | 5748 cc | 1496 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 12 cylinders | 4 cylinders |
Engine Type | V | in-line |
Valves per Cylinder | 4 valves | 4 valves |
Horse Power | 508 HP | 108 HP |
Engine RPM | 7250 RPM | 5800 RPM |
Torque | 588 Nm | 143 Nm |
Torque RPM | 5250 RPM | 4800 RPM |
Fuel Type | Gasoline - Premium | Gasoline |
Number of Seats | 2 seats | 7 seats |
Vehicle Weight | 1734 kg | 1260 kg |
Vehicle Length | 4560 mm | 4120 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1940 mm | 1650 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1280 mm | 1750 mm |
